**Migration Step 4: DeployParrot cutover**

DeployParrot (the chat bot posting deploy status to Brimble channels) moves from the legacy Oxhall host to the new Varn cluster. Revoke the old host's webhook permissions before cutover; the bot needs only read access to the deploy event stream. Verify scopes match the audit sheet. The target cluster config is listed here.

service settings:
[casax]
port = 6379
team = rusir
host = casax.zemvarhq.corp
region = outer-4
access_code = ac_9808ce
timeout_ms = 1500

Handover for plugin authors: the Givewell-style receipt mailer (project Almsgate) now renders templates server-side, so plugins should emit structured donation records, not HTML. Retry logic lives in the mailer core; don't duplicate it. Sandbox credentials rotate monthly, and the staging queue drains nightly at 02:00. Mira handled template localization; her notes are on the Almsgate wiki. To restore the plugin signing keystore after rotation, unlock it with the recovery passphrase that follows.

unlock words, tadup-yawep: oliael-sorox

# Break-Glass: Catalog Cache Invalidation

Scope: the Pinrow product catalog at Veldstone Retail. If stale prices persist after a purge and the Hollowmere invalidation queue is wedged, use break-glass to flush the edge tier directly. Contractors: get verbal sign-off from the catalog lead first. Steps: open the Hollowmere admin shell, select emergency-flush, confirm the tenant, and run it once — repeated flushes thrash the origin. Access is logged and expires after 20 minutes. Unseal the admin shell with the passphrase below.

recovery phrase for kahop-tajog: istix-casvan

Night Shift Visitor Policy — Server Room Access (Quillbrook Annex)

Quick reminder for the overnight crew: nobody goes into the server room after hours without being on the approved list, full stop. If a vendor turns up claiming an emergency call-out, ring the duty engineer first — don't just take their word for it. Once they're verified, sign them in, badge them as an escorted visitor, and stay with them the whole time. The server room door sits on its own keypad, separate from the main system, so use the after-hours code below.

staff pass of haweg-bafop = bdg-G-69